Ir para conteúdo
  • Cadastre-se

dev botao

Consulta de notas não faz a leitura de todas as notas no XML


Ver Solução Respondido por Italo Giurizzato Junior,

Recommended Posts

  • Membros Pro
Postado

Boa tarde.

Estamos com uma situação onde a consulta de notas por faixa de número retorno um XML com várias notas porém algumas notas não são lidas (ou são ignoradas) pelo componente ACBRNFSeX.

No exemplo anexo, fizemos um consulta da número 53 a a 60. A consulta retornou um XML com notas de 53 a 56 (correto pois é o que tem no WebServices), no entanto as notas 55 e 56 são ignoradas pelo componente. 

Anexo esta o arquivo de retorno das notas consultadas.
 

image.png.aeac26c886cbc5c6bf7631f4c271a0b4.png

 

image.thumb.png.c01ceaa852046307849c9119e3b8c1e2.png

temp2.xml

  • Consultores
  • Solution
Postado

Boa tarde @Weber de Paula,

Primeiramente você não configurou o componente para salvar o XML em disco, pela imagem em anexo.

Segundo ao ler os dados da nota de numero 55 ocorreu um erro, é bem provável que o XML dessa nota contem algum caracter ou informação que esteja gerando o erro.

Analisando o arquivo que você anexou encontrei isso na nota de numero 55:

image.png

Tenho quase certeza que o problema é esse ao tentar ler o XML da nota.

Consultor SAC ACBr

Italo Giurizzato Junior
Ajude o Projeto ACBr crescer - Assine o SAC

Projeto ACBr

Analista de Sistemas / Araraquara-SP

Araraquara - A era dos Trólebus

  • Membros Pro
Postado
1 hora atrás, Italo Giurizzato Junior disse:

Boa tarde @Weber de Paula,

Primeiramente você não configurou o componente para salvar o XML em disco, pela imagem em anexo.

Segundo ao ler os dados da nota de numero 55 ocorreu um erro, é bem provável que o XML dessa nota contem algum caracter ou informação que esteja gerando o erro.

Analisando o arquivo que você anexou encontrei isso na nota de numero 55:

image.png

Tenho quase certeza que o problema é esse ao tentar ler o XML da nota.

Pra salvar em disco estava certo, o componente salva todas as notas exceto as duas com problemas.

Realmente esse era o problema, editei o arquivo manualmente e deu certo.

Desculpa pela falta de atenção nesse item. Algo básico que passou despercebido.

Obrigado!

Visitante
Este tópico está agora fechado para novas respostas
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.